(转载) 什么是Solana,它如何运作?

Solana 爱好者
·
·
IPFS

原文作者SASHA SHILINA


原文地址什么是Solana,它如何运作? | Cointelegraph中文 (cointelegraphcn.com)

Solana的野心是解决区块链三难困境;然而,它仍然存在着各种缺陷,如易中心化等。

什么是Solana?

Solana是一个功能强大的开源项目,它实现了一个新的、无许可的、高速的layer-1区块链。

Solana由高通前高管Anatoly Yakovenko于2017年创建,其目标是在保持低成本的同时扩大吞吐量,超越流行的区块链通常实现的水平。Solana实现了一种创新的混合共识模型,将独特的历史证明(PoH)算法与闪电般快速的同步引擎(也就是另一种版本的权益证明,PoS)相结合。因此,理论上Solana网络可以在不需要任何扩展解决方案的情况下每秒处理超过710000笔交易(TPS)。 

Solana的第三代区块链架构旨在促进智能合约和去中心化应用程序(DApp)的创建。该项目支持一系列去中心化金融(DeFi)平台以及非同质化代币(NFT)市场。

Solana区块链在2017年的区块链热潮期间推出。该项目的内部测试网于2018年发布,随后经过多个测试网阶段,最终于2020年正式推出主网络。

Solana有什么独特之处?

Solana的野心是以其独特的方式解决区块链三难困境,这是以太坊创始人Vitalik Buterin提出的概念。这个三难困境描述了开发者在构建区块链时面临的三大挑战: 去中心化、安全性和可扩展性。

人们普遍认为,区块链的构建方式迫使开发者牺牲其中一个方面,以支持其他两个方面,因为在任何给定的时间,它们最多都只能三选二。

Solana区块链平台提出了一种混合共识机制,在去中心化上妥协,以最大化速度。PoS与PoH的创新结合,使Solana成为区块链行业中独一无二的项目。

一般来说,区块链具有更大的可扩展性,这取决于它们每秒支持的交易数量(TPS)——TPS越高,它们的可扩展性就越强。然而,在去中心化的区块链中,时间差异和更高的吞吐量降低了它们的速度,这意味着验证交易的节点和时间戳越多,所花费的时间就越多。

简单地说,Solana的设计通过基于PoS机制选择一个领导节点来解决这个问题,PoS机制在节点之间对消息进行排序。因此,Solana网络的好处在于,即使没有集中和精确的时间源,也能减少工作负载,从而提高吞吐量。

此外,Solana通过散列一笔交易的输出并将其用作下一笔交易的输入来创建一个交易链。Solana的主要共识机制的名称就来自这段交易的历史: PoH (Proof of History),这个概念赋予协议更大的可扩展性,从而提高可用性。

Solana如何运作?

Solana协议的核心构成是历史证明(proof-of-history),这是一个提供数字记录的计算序列,用于确认网络上任何时间点发生的交易。它可以表示为一个加密时钟,为网络上的每笔交易提供一个时间戳,以及一个可以简单添加的数据结构。

PoH依赖于使用基站拜占庭容错(BFT)算法的PoS,这是实用拜占庭容错(pBFT)协议的优化版本。Solana用它来实现共识。基站拜占庭容错(Tower BFT)保持网络安全运行,并额外充当验证交易的工具。

此外,PoH可以被认为是一个高频可验证延迟函数(VDF),一个可以产生独特和可靠输出的三重功能(设置、评估、验证)。VDF通过证明区块生产者已经为网络的前进等待了足够的时间来维持网络中的秩序。

Solana使用256位安全哈希算法(SHA-256),这是一组输出256位值的专有加密函数。网络会周期性地对数字和SHA-256哈希值进行采样,根据中央处理单元包含的哈希值集提供实时数据。

Solana验证器可以使用此哈希序列来记录在生成特定哈希索引之前创建的特定数据。交易的时间戳是在插入此特定数据块之后创建的。为了实现声称的大量TPS和块创建时间,网络上的所有节点都必须有加密时钟来跟踪事件,而不是等待其他验证器来验证交易。


Solana (SOL) 代币

Solana的加密货币是SOL。它是Solana的原生和实用代币,提供了一种转移价值的方式,也可以通过质押来保证区块链安全。SOL于2020年3月推出,现在已经成为了加密领域市值前十的加密货币之一。

SOL代币运作方案与以太坊区块链中使用的类似。尽管它们的功能类似,但SOL持有者质押代币,以通过PoS共识机制验证交易。此外,Solana代币用于接收奖励和支付交易费用,同时SOL还允许用户参与治理。

关于Solana的代币总量,将会有超过5亿枚流通代币,目前Solana的总供应量超过5.11亿代币——Solana的流通供应量刚好超过这个数字的一半。大约60%的SOL代币由Solana的创始人和Solana基金会控制,只有38%预留给社区。

SOL可以在大多数交易所购买。Solana的顶级加密货币交易所包括Binance、Coinbase、KuCoin、Huobi、FTX等。

Solana vs.以太坊

Solana因其速度和性能获得了许多赞誉,甚至被认为是以太坊等加密行业领袖旗鼓相当的竞争对手。

那么,Solana与以太坊有何不同?它是否可以被视为潜在的以太坊杀手?

在处理速度方面,Solana能够挑战智能合约平台的主导地位,据称其速度可以达到50000 TPS以上。Solana使用不同的共识算法来避免缓慢的交易确认。这一特性使Solana成为业内最快的区块链之一,在加密领域之外的其他行业也极其竞争力。

与这个巨大的数字相比,目前可扩展性较低的以太坊工作量证明模型只能处理15 TPS。因此,Solana比以太坊快数千倍。Solana的另一个优势是该网络极高的成本效益,因为它实施了新的代币经济学,降低了费用。

此外,值得一提的是,Solana的区块链实现了PoS的一个变体,更环保和可持续。相比之下,以太坊目前的PoW模型需要消耗巨大的算力。

然而,加密社区的每个人都在期待以太坊升级到PoS。一种正在努力开发的新型以太坊将由执行层(以前称为以太坊1.0)和共识层(以前称为以太坊2.0)组成。它可以大大提高吞吐量,提高可扩展性,降低交易费用,并停止不可持续的电力消耗。

Solana的缺点

如果你还在想Solana是不是一个好的投资,是否应该购买,答案仍然取决于你自己。尽管有明显的优势,但与任何现有加密项目一样,Solana也有其缺点。

首先,虽然Solana区块链可以与高端区块链项目竞争,但它仍然容易受到中心化的影响,因为它的区块链验证器并不多。网络上的任何人都可以成为Solana验证器,但是这样做仍然很困难,因为需要大量的计算资源。

与此同时,Solana协议仍将自己标记为主网的beta版本,换言之,它并不否认可能存在bug和错误。

尽管存在这些问题,Solana仍然是加密行业最大的生态系统之一,而且似乎正走在正确的增长道路上。



唯一 建议不炒币

CC BY-NC-ND 2.0 授权

喜欢我的作品吗?别忘了给予支持与赞赏,让我知道在创作的路上有你陪伴,一起延续这份热忱!